Página 1 de 1
#1 Programar CPLD's
Publicado: 23 Sep 2020 09:45
por merlinkv
Esto va para todos, pero quizá más especialmente para
pintza.
¿Como gaitas hacéis para programar las CPLD's como las de EasyFlash o Kung-Fu Flash? .... ¿Que hardware y software necesito?
#2 Re: Programar CPLD's
Publicado: 23 Sep 2020 11:20
por Bone
Pues yo no le veo ningún cpld al Kung-fu Flash.....igual lo tiene por la otra cara....no se....
Lo único que veo es un microcontrolador ARM....supongo que se programara como todos....

#3 Re: Programar CPLD's
Publicado: 23 Sep 2020 11:46
por merlinkv
Bone escribió: 23 Sep 2020 11:20
Pues yo no le veo ningún cpld al Kung-fu Flash.....igual lo tiene por la otra cara....no se....
Lo único que veo es un microcontrolador ARM....supongo que se programara como todos....
Tienes razón ...metedura de gamba por mi parte ....
De todas formas ¿que adaptadores o cables se usan comunmente para las CPLD's?
#4 Re: Programar CPLD's
Publicado: 23 Sep 2020 11:54
por pintza
Pues si, el Kung fu flash lleva un microcontrolador y para programarlo compré el ST-Link V2. Es un interface que con el software de STM32 programas directamente el microcontrolador. Un microcontrolador es un todo en uno, en un mismo chip tienes todo: puerto serie, memoria, procesador .....
Para el EasyFlash es mucho más complicado. Primero tienes que programar el chip FT245R, al hacerlo habilitas el puerto USB y ya desde el propio puerto USB puedes programar la CPLD desde la línea de comandos de un PC, con la aplicación Easp.
También lo puedes programar directamente con la aplicación de Xilinx pero la forma anteriormente descrita es la correcta.
Todo esto dicho muy muy muy por encima.
#5 Re: Programar CPLD's
Publicado: 23 Sep 2020 12:06
por merlinkv
OK, gracias.
Es que no tengo ni idea y quiero ir poniéndome un poco al día con el tema.
Ya os daré la turra ya ....

#6 Re: Programar CPLD's
Publicado: 23 Sep 2020 15:10
por Bone
#7 Re: Programar CPLD's
Publicado: 23 Sep 2020 15:42
por Bone
merlinkv escribió: 23 Sep 2020 11:46
¿que adaptadores o cables se usan comunmente para las CPLD's?
Yo si tengo que programar una CPLD de Xilinx uso
este cable, y si es de Altera pues el USB Blaster que ya tienes para la Vampire...

#8 Re: Programar CPLD's
Publicado: 23 Sep 2020 17:02
por merlinkv
Ahora ando detrás de poder grabar unas ATF1502ASL-25AU44, pero "a pelo" .. es decir no van soldadas en ninguna placa con toma JTAG.
He estado buscando y no veo ná de ná ....

#9 Re: Programar CPLD's
Publicado: 23 Sep 2020 22:10
por Bone
merlinkv escribió: 23 Sep 2020 17:02
ATF1502ASL-25AU44
Nunca he usado una de estas....¿es para fabricar C64 PLA´s?......

#10 Re: Programar CPLD's
Publicado: 24 Sep 2020 09:26
por droman
merlinkv escribió: 23 Sep 2020 17:02
ATF1502ASL-25AU44
La P de Pamplona y si me quedan tiradas, compro vocal y resuelvo.

#11 Re: Programar CPLD's
Publicado: 24 Sep 2020 09:48
por merlinkv
Bone escribió: 23 Sep 2020 22:10Nunca he usado una de estas....¿es para fabricar C64 PLA´s?......

Pues la verdad es que no lo sé. Me preguntó un conocido que creía que mi programador podía con ellas, pero no es así y luego me entró el gusanillo de saber como hacerlo.
Lo que sí he visto es lo que comentas, que estas se usan para algunos clones de PLA de los C64.
#12 Re: Programar CPLD's
Publicado: 24 Sep 2020 17:46
por Bone
merlinkv escribió: 24 Sep 2020 09:48
...que estas se usan para algunos clones de PLA de los C64...
Sí, hay unos proyectos de PLA's que los usasn......yo me decanté por Xilinx porque conozco la plataforma desde hace tiempo...